Subject: Gatewing cut-over complete — websocket reconnect fix live

Hello plugin authors,

Last night we cut Gatewing over to the patched relay tier. The reconnect bug that dropped subscriptions after idle timeouts is resolved; clients now resume with their prior session token, so plugins no longer need manual re-subscribe logic. Please verify your reconnect handlers against staging before Friday. For reference, the relay now runs with the following settings.

service settings:
PRAWYN_PIN=9848
PRAWYN_METRICS_HOST=metrics.prawyn.lumicworks.corp
PRAWYN_LOG_LEVEL=warn
PRAWYN_TENANT=pelius

Subject: DR drill — rotomat secrets-rotation utility

Drill complete. Rotomat rotated staging secrets in 9 minutes; prod simulation passed. One finding: the rollback path assumes the old secret is still cached — review the diff in the rollback branch before approving. Restoring the sealed rotation store during the drill required manual entry of the recovery passphrase below.

vault phrase of bagaf-kajeg = jorath-feniel-briir-siliel-ralix

Onboarding: Ledgerlens audit-log viewer. Ledgerlens reads from the Quillbrook event store and renders immutable audit trails for compliance reviews. Access is read-only; filters support actor, action, and time range. Do not query the event store directly — Ledgerlens applies redaction rules that raw queries bypass. New folks should demo a sample trail before the weekly sync. Setup steps, redaction policy summary, and known quirks for the current release are collected on the internal page linked below.

dashboard of yafog-fajof = https://jira.tolvaqsys.internal/pages/pages/projects/49fe21c4

## Build Provenance — Fieldline Telemetry Gateway

The Fieldline gateway firmware for Harrowmark tractors is built nightly on the Oxbow runner. Each image embeds a manifest listing compiler version, dependency digests, and the signing key generation. On-call: if a unit reports a mismatch, compare its manifest against the nightly record before rolling back. Every provenance check must be logged against the build token shown below.

pipeline stamp: htk31_f769b577b3028a4e9958e5bb8d1259a